Aimee George Leary is one of the most influential Chief People Officers in the global professional services sector—widely respected for architecting enterprise-wide talent strategies, values-driven culture transformation, and future-ready workforce ecosystems at scale. Currently serving as Executive Vice President and Chief People Officer at Booz Allen Hamilton, Aimee leads people strategy for more than 35,000 professionals worldwide, positioning talent as a primary driver of innovation, client impact, and long-term enterprise growth.
With over three decades of leadership at Booz Allen, Aimee has played a defining role in shaping the firm’s modern talent architecture. She has led record-breaking hiring cycles, strengthened employee experience outcomes, and built one of the most admired values-based cultures in consulting—anchored in well-being, continuous development, inclusion, and connection. Her leadership has ensured Booz Allen remains a sought-after employer while sustaining high-performance delivery for global clients.
Previously serving as Talent Strategy Officer, Chief Administrative Officer for Strategic Innovation, and a leader of firmwide transformation initiatives, Aimee has architected employee value propositions, leadership development systems, predictive workforce analytics, diversity roadmaps, and innovation cultures that have earned the firm multiple industry honors.
Beyond enterprise leadership, Aimee serves on the Board of Unified Youth, championing youth mental health advocacy and community empowerment initiatives.
Educated at Indiana University of Pennsylvania, Commonwealth University-Bloomsburg, and Harvard Business School Executive Education, Aimee’s mission remains clear:
to build people ecosystems where values, innovation, and human connection become the strongest engines of sustainable enterprise excellence.
